# Release ## Release cycle A release should be created at least every 2 weeks. ## Release creation > [!IMPORTANT] > Consider informing / syncing with the team before creating a new release. 1. Check out latest main branch on your machine 2. Create git tag: `git tag vX.X.X` 3. Push the git tag: `git push origin --tags` 4. The [release pipeline](https://github.com/stackitcloud/terraform-provider-stackit/actions/workflows/release.yaml) will build the release and publish it on GitHub 5. Ensure the release was created properly using the - [GitHub releases page](https://github.com/stackitcloud/terraform-provider-stackit/releases) - [Terraform registry](https://registry.terraform.io/providers/stackitcloud/stackit/latest) ## Troubleshooting In case the release only shows up as a draft release in the Terraform registry, check the state of the registry update in the [settings](https://github.com/stackitcloud/terraform-provider-stackit/settings/hooks): - Select 'edit' for the terraform registry webhook (requires authentication) - Switch to the "recent deliveries" tab - Check the last release, it should have positive result value and no error indication If the delivery failed or complains that the release is a draft, try to temporariliy declare the release as a pre-release in GitHub and then revert it it immediately.
